About Converting Stones per Cup to US hundredweights per Milliliter

Stone per Cup and US hundredweight per Milliliter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

us hundredweights per milliliter = stones per cup × 0.000591745397282

This factor comes from each unit's defined relationship to the category's base unit: 1 stone per cup equals 26841.119719 base units, and 1 us hundredweight per milliliter equals 45359237 base units, so dividing one by the other gives the direct stone per cup-to-us hundredweight per milliliter factor of 0.000591745397282.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
